Sightseeing
The Fort and Abbaye Saint André is in Villeneuve les Avignon (just across the river from Avignon). The owners are lovely and the gardens are amazing. Go early and avoid the heat.

The village of Sault (pronounced like "sew") west of Mont Ventoux is the place for lavender. If you want to admire the huge lavender fields and stroll a beautiful hilltop village you will love it.

The Popes Palace (Palais des Papes) in Avignon is very interesting, and Avignon is nice to stroll around, especially some of the smaller back roads.

The Roman Theater in Orange is one of only 3 left in the world with an intact stage wall. It makes a nice 1/2 day visit if you like history.

The Roman aqueduct in Nimes is spectacular. That is a nice afternoon too. Perhaps combine with a trip to Arles (the Wed. market in Arles is HUGE), and see the Roman museum and arena.
